Circulating supply is the count of a project's tokens considered available in the market right now, excluding tokens held in vesting contracts, treasury wallets and other holdings judged to be out of circulation. It is the denominator of token market cap, which makes it one of the most consequential figures a project publishes. It is also not a measurement. CoinMarketCap calls it the best approximation and says outright that the network at large has no reliable knowledge of how much of the total supply is in active circulation.
Circulating supply is a judgement, not a fact. Somebody decides which tokens are out of circulation, different data providers decide differently, and if you do not publish your own supply accounting they will decide it for you.

The chain does not know what is circulating
A blockchain can tell you exactly how many tokens exist and exactly which address holds each one. It cannot tell you whether an address is a treasury, a burn address nobody registered, a founder's cold wallet under a two-year contractual lockup, a bridge escrow, or an exchange omnibus. Circulating supply requires classifying every one of those, and that classification is a human decision applied from outside the protocol.
CoinMarketCap says this in its own glossary rather than burying it: circulating supply is the best approximation of the number of coins circulating in the market and in the general public's hands, and the network at large has no reliable knowledge of how much of the total supply is in active circulation, making the metric an imperfect approximation.1
Once you accept that, the follow-on questions change. Not what is the circulating supply, but who computed it, from what rules, and against what evidence the project provided.
Bitcoin's number is an estimate too
The cleanest illustration comes from the asset with the most transparent supply schedule in existence. CoinMarketCap's worked example notes that Bitcoin's nominal circulating supply is the amount mined since inception, over 18 million coins in that example, while an estimated 4 million BTC have been permanently lost, placing the true circulating supply closer to 14 million.1
The mined total keeps climbing with every block. The lost portion never appears in any published supply figure, because there is no way to prove a private key is gone. So the number everyone quotes, including the one that feeds Bitcoin's market cap, carries an unstated overcount of roughly a fifth by the reporting provider's own estimate.
If that is the state of the most auditable supply in the category, treat every altcoin circulating supply as an approximation with wider error bars, not as a figure to build a comparison table on.
Where the calls actually get made
Tokens locked in a smart contract are counted in total supply and excluded from circulating supply. CoinMarketCap gives ICO vesting stages as its example of tokens locked until a particular purpose is achieved.2 That case is straightforward because the lock is onchain and anyone can read it.
The difficult cases are the ones with no contract to read. A foundation treasury sitting in a multisig with a published policy but no code enforcing it. A team allocation subject to a lockup written into an employment agreement. Tokens bridged to a chain the provider's indexer does not cover. Market maker inventory on loan. Each is a call, and a project that has not documented its own position will find the call made without it.
The design consequence is that circulating supply is something you can specify rather than something that happens to you. Publish the address list, the lock contracts, the policy for any wallet not under code control, and the schedule that moves tokens between categories. Providers generally follow a project that gives them something verifiable to follow.
Agreement is not the same as accuracy
Reading Ethena from both major providers on 3 August 2026, the supply figures matched exactly: 9,560,937,500 circulating against a total and max supply of 15,000,000,000, a float of 63.74%.3 CoinMarketCap showed the same 9.56 billion against 15 billion on the same day.4
That is what well documented supply looks like, and the contrast is sharp: the same pair of reads produced a roughly 6% disagreement on TVL for that protocol. When a project publishes clean, verifiable supply accounting, the providers converge. When it does not, they diverge, and the project inherits whatever they each decided.
It also does not mean the number is correct. Two providers agreeing tells you they applied compatible rules to the same evidence. It does not tell you the rules match economic reality, which is the separate question of how much of that 9.56 billion could realistically be sold this quarter.
Why this figure is commercially load-bearing
Circulating supply sets the market cap denominator, and market cap governs index inclusion, exchange listing tiers, screener rankings and the comparables tables in every investor deck in the category. A supply classification decision made by a data team you have never spoken to can move your token between visibility brackets.
It also sets the reference point for every unlock announcement. If your published float is understated, each unlock looks proportionally larger than it is and reads as a bigger supply shock. If it is overstated, market cap flatters the project now and every future unlock lands with less warning than it should have had.
Neither of those is a market problem. Both are documentation problems, which means both are fixable before launch at close to zero cost.
What we tell founders to publish
One supply page, maintained, with five things on it. Every address holding project-controlled tokens, labelled. The lock contract for each, with the address so anyone can verify it. A written policy for any holding not under code control, because that is the category providers guess at. The unlock schedule with dates and amounts. And a plain statement of which holdings you consider outside circulation and why.
Then hold that definition still. Changing your own circulating supply methodology mid-cycle produces a step change in reported market cap that looks like something happened in the market when nothing did, and it costs credibility with the people you least want to spend it on.
Common questions
What is circulating supply in crypto?
Circulating supply is the number of a project's tokens judged to be available in the market, excluding tokens locked in vesting contracts, treasury holdings and similar. It is the denominator used to calculate market cap. CoinMarketCap describes it as the best approximation of coins circulating in the general public's hands, and states that the network has no reliable knowledge of how much supply is actually in active circulation.1
Who decides a token's circulating supply?
Data providers do, using rules they set themselves and evidence the project supplies. Onchain lock contracts are easy to verify. Foundation treasuries, contractually restricted team allocations, bridged balances and market maker inventory are judgement calls. A project that publishes a labelled address list, its lock contracts and its unlock schedule usually gets that documentation followed, rather than having the classification guessed at.
What is the difference between circulating supply and total supply?
Total supply is every token that exists, including those locked and inaccessible. Circulating supply is the subset judged available in the market. CoinMarketCap notes that total supply includes pre-mined coins intentionally kept out of circulation and tokens locked in smart contracts, such as during ICO vesting stages.2 The gap between the two figures is supply scheduled to reach the market later.
Is circulating supply the same as tokens that can be sold?
No, and treating them as the same is a common error. Circulating supply includes coins that are unreachable, such as the estimated 4 million BTC CoinMarketCap describes as permanently lost against a nominal figure of over 18 million.1 It also includes long-term holdings nobody intends to sell. What can actually be sold in a given week is a much smaller number governed by order book depth.
